Social and Affordable Housing.
1:00 pm
Eamon Gilmore (Dún Laoghaire, Labour)
Question 56: To ask the Minister for the Environment, Heritage and Local Government his views on the conclusions of the recent NESC report on housing, that an additional 73,000 social housing units must be built by 2011; the plans he has to increase social housing output to this level; the way in which it is intended to meet increased social housing targets in the larger urban areas, in which building land is scarce; and if he will make a statement on the matter.
